A supramolecular benzothiophene heterocyclic host complex was successfully prepared by combining benzo[b]thiophene-3-acetic acid and chiral (1R,2S)-2-amino-1,2-diphenylethanol. Four types of n-alkyl alcohols could be stored as guests in one-dimensional channel-like cavities composed of 21-helical columnar network structures. The release temperatures of the stored guest alcohols could be multiply tuned according to the type of the benzothiophene unit in the complex. This journal is

A number of half-salen aluminum complexes bearing unsymmetrical [ONN]-type ligands were prepared from tridentate dinaphthalene-imine derivatives. These complexes were characterized by 1H and 13C NMR spectroscopy, elemental analysis and single crystal X-ray diffraction analysis. These complexes were employed for rac-lactide and l-lactide polymerization. Upon activation with isopropanol, complex (S)-B6 (R1 = R2 = R4 = H; R3 = F) showed the highest activity (a monomer conversion of 94.6%) amid these aluminum complexes for the ring-opening polymerization of L-lactide; and complex (S)-B2 (R1 = R2 = R3 = H; R4 = tBu) showed the highest stereoselectivity for the ring-opening polymerization of rac-lactide, obtaining a polylactide (PLA) with a Pm of 0.69. The polymerization kinetics utilizing (S)-B6 as a catalyst were researched in detail. The data on the polymerization kinetics revealed that the rate of polymerization was first-order with respect to the monomer and the catalyst. There was a linear relationship between the L-lactide conversion and the number-average molecular weight of PLA.

[Ni(H2O)6][Cu3Cl8(H2O)2] · (15-crown-5)2 · 2H2O can be conveniently prepared by the interaction of NiCl2 · 6H2O, CuCl2 · 2H2O and 15-crown-5 in water. The X-ray crystal structure reveals an ionic complex involved in a hydrogen-bonded two dimensional network with the [Ni(H2O)6]2+ and [Cu3Cl8(H2O)2]2- ions sandwiched between the 15-crown-5 macrocycles. The magnetic susceptibility data (4-300 K) and magnetisation isotherms (2-5.5 K; 0-5 T) are best interpreted in terms of intra-trimer ferromagnetic coupling within the [Cu3Cl8(H2O)2]2- moieties, with J ? 6 cm-1, and antiferromagnetic coupling between the trimers, the latter mediated by H-bonding pathways. Comparisons are made to other reported quaternary ammonium salts of [Cu3Cl8]2- and [Cu3Cl12]6-, most of which display structures that involve close stacking of such Cu(II) trimers, rather than being of the present isolated, albeit H-bonded, types.

Condensation and subsequent reduction of 2,2?-diaminobiphenyls 5 with 6?- and 5?-substituted 6-carbaldehyde-2,2?-bipyridines 4 yielded N,N?-bis(2,2?-bipyridine-6-ylmethyl)-2,2?-biphenyl- enediamines 7, which were employed as hexadendate ligands with N6 donor sets in the synthesis of dicationic [Fe2+(7-kappa6N)] complexes 8. Dependent on the substitution pattern the respective complexes are found in the HS state (8b and 8c) or show SCO behaviour. By means of temperature- dependent susceptibility measurements, usingEvans’ method, the thermodynamic parameters DeltaH, DeltaS and T1/2 for the SCO have been determined. T1/2 as well as DeltaH are remarkably susceptible to substitution next to the central C-C bond of the biphenyl bridge. A new series of ligands with an AB2 structure were synthesized and employed in Fe2+ SCO complexes. DeltaH, DeltaS and T1/2 for the SCO were determined using Evans’ method. The results clearly show a dependency of the spin state on the substitution pattern. The steric effects of substituents placed at the 6 and 6? positions in the biphenyl moiety are effectively transported through the biphenyl bridge. Copyright

The lipase TL-mediated kinetic resolution of (±)-benzoin (1) proceeded to give the corresponding optically pure benzoin (R)-1. On the other hand, (S)-benzoin-O-acetate (5) could be hydrolyzed without epimerization to give (S)-benzoin (S)-1, under alkaline conditions. Further, (R)-1 was converted to (1R,2S)-2-amino-1,2-diphenylethanol (99:1 er) according to the procedure reported previously. (C) 2000 Elsevier Science Ltd.

Alkali metal cations (Na+, K+) and crown ether molecules (12C4, 15C5, 18C6) were used as additional reactants during the hydrothermal synthesis of uranyl ion complexes with cis/trans-1,3-, cis-1,2- and trans-1,2-cyclohexanedicarboxylic acids (c/t-1,3-chdcH2, c-1,2-chdcH2, and t-1,2-chdcH2, respectively, the latter as racemic or pure (1R,2R) enantiomer). Oxalate anions generated in situ are present in all the six complexes isolated and crystallographically characterized, [(UO2)2(c-1,3-chdc)2(C2O4)][UO2(H2O)5]·(12C4)·2H2O (1), [(UO2)4Na2(c-1,2-chdc)2(C2O4)3(15C5)2] (2), [(UO2)4K2(c-1,2-chdc)2(C2O4)3(18C6)1.5(H2O)1.5] (3), [(UO2)12K5(R-t-1,2-chdc)4(C2O4)10(18C6)5(OH)(H2O)3]·4H2O (4), [(UO2)12K5(rac-t-1,2-chdc)4(C2O4)10(18C6)5(OH)(H2O)3]·4H2O (5), and [(UO2)8K4(rac-t-1,2-chdc)4(C2O4)6(18C6)3(H2O)2] (6). In complex 1, the [UO2(H2O)5]2+ counterions link the ladderlike uranyl-containing one-dimensional polymers and the uncomplexed crown ether molecules through hydrogen bonds. In all the other complexes, two-dimensional uranyl/chdc/oxalate subunits are formed, with topologies depending on the stoichiometry, in which the 1,2-chdc2- ligands are bound to three uranium atoms, one of them chelated by the two carboxylate groups, and the oxalate ligands are bis-chelating. In complex 2, the Na(15C5)+ cations are bound to one layer through double Na-carboxylate or Na-oxo cis-bonding and they are thus mere decorating groups. In contrast, the quasi-planar K(18C6)+ groups in 3-6, partially affected by disorder, are generally trans-coordinated to two uranyl oxo groups pertaining to different layers, thus uniting the latter into a three-dimensional framework.
